Eugene Cat Name Meaning
A classic Greek name, Eugene has a distinguished history.
- Origin: The name Eugene originates from the ancient Greek word "eugenes."
- Literal meaning: It directly translates to "well-born" or "noble," reflecting a sense of inherent quality.
- Cultural significance: Saint Eugene of Toledo was a prominent archbishop and poet. Eugene Levy is a beloved actor known for his comedic roles.
- Why it works for cats: The name has a gentle yet stately sound, suiting cats with a calm demeanor or a regal appearance.
- Pronunciation: Pronounced "YOO-jeen," it is a two-syllable name with a soft start and clear ending.
